NeighbourhoodThis detached house on Oude Roswinkelerweg sits on a generous 18,535 m² plot, offering space and privacy on the edge of Emmen. Built in 1980, the 125 m² home has an energy label C. At €1,595,000, the price is on the high side compared to other detached houses in Emmen.
The Verspreide huizen Emmen neighbourhood is a rural area with a low address density of 415 addresses per km², making it one of the least urbanised parts of the municipality. Almost all homes (98%) are single-family houses, and 84% are owner-occupied. The population of around 850 is spread out, with a mix of ages: the largest group is 45 to 65 years old. For daily groceries, the nearest supermarkets are Lidl and Jumbo, both about 2 km away, a short drive or a pleasant walk. Primary schools within walking distance include Openbare Basisschool De Esdoorn and RK/PC Jenaplanschool Kristalla. The train station is 3.3 km away, and a park or public garden is just under 1 km from the house. The municipality of Emmen provides the broader amenities, including restaurants and a library within a few kilometres.
